The Local Skinny! Suspect Takes His Own Life Following Double Shooting In Southern Granville

December 11, 2025
Two people remain hospitalized Thursday following a shooting Tuesday in southern Granville County. The alleged shooter died near the scene from a self-inflicted gunshot wound following an hours-long standoff with law enforcement. In a press conference on Wednesday, Granville County Sheriff Robert Fountain identified the alleged suspect as 27-year-old Bradley McCurdy. During the press conference...

The Local Skinny! Vance County Train Derailment Spills Dog Food Supplement; No Injuries Reported

December 9, 2025
A train derailment last week at Eastern Minerals caused a supplement used in dog food to spill, but officials said there was never any danger to the public or to the environment. The incident occurred at 11:59 p.m. on Wednesday, Dec. 3, according to CSX officials. Clean-up of the product, a food grade Zinc used...
